中文 | English
Pake
特征
下载
| WeRead Mac Linux Windows | Twitter Mac Linux Windows |
![]() |
![]() |
| ChatGPT Mac Linux Windows | Qwerty Mac Linux Windows |
![]() |
![]() |
| Code Mac Linux Windows | Reference Mac Linux Windows |
![]() |
![]() |
| YouTube Mac Linux Windows | Flomo Mac Linux Windows |
![]() |
![]() |
命令行打包
Pake 提供了命令行工具,可以更快捷方便地一键自定义打�?需要的包,详细可见 文档。
// 使用 npm 进行安装
npm install -g pake-cli
// 命令使用
pake url [options]
// 随便玩玩,首次由于安装环境会有些慢,后面就快了
pake https://weekly.tw93.fun --name Weekly --transparent假如�?不太会使用命令行,或许使用 GitHub Actions 在线编译多系统版本 是一个不错的选择,可查看文档。
快捷键
| Mac | Windows/Linux | 功能 |
|---|---|---|
| ⌘ + [ | Ctrl + ← | 返回上一个页面 |
| ⌘ + ] | Ctrl + → | 去下一个页面 |
| ⌘ + ↑ | Ctrl + ↑ | 自动滚动到页面顶部 |
| ⌘ + ↓ | Ctrl + ↓ | 自动滚动到页面底部 |
| ⌘ + r | Ctrl + r | 刷新页面 |
| ⌘ + w | Ctrl + w | 隐藏窗口,非退出 |
| ⌘ + - | Ctrl + - | 缩小页面 |
| ⌘ + + | Ctrl + + | 放大页面 |
| ⌘ + = | Ctrl + = | 放大页面 |
| ⌘ + 0 | Ctrl + 0 | 重置页面缩放 |
此外还支持双击头部进行全屏切换,拖拽头部进行移动窗口,还有其他需求,欢迎提过来。
定制开发
开始前请确保电脑已经安装了 Rust 和 Node 的环境,此外需参考 Tauri 文档 快速配置好环境才可以开始使用,假如�?太不懂,使用上面的命令行打包会更�?合适。
// 安装依赖
npm i
// 调试
npm run dev
// 打包应用
npm run build
高级使用
- 修改
src-tauri目录下的tauri.conf.json中的url、productName、icon、identifier这 4 个字段,其中 icon 可以从 icons 目录选择一个,也可以去 macOSicons 下载符合产品名称的。 - 关于窗口属性设置,可以在
tauri.conf.json修改windows属性对应的width/height,是否全屏fullscreen,是否可以调整大小resizable,假如想适配 Mac 沉浸式头部,可以将transparent设置成true,找到 Header 元�?�?一个padding-top�?�式即可,不想适配改成false也行。 npm run dev本地调试看看效果,此外可以使用npm run dev:debug进行容器调试,npm run build运行即可打生产包。- 代�?�结构可参考 文档,关于�?�式改写、屏蔽广告、逻辑代�?�注入、容器消息通信、自定义快捷键可见 高级用法。
开发者
Pake 的发展离不开这些 Hacker 们,一起贡献了大量能力,也欢迎关注他们
|
Tw93 |
Tlntin |
Pan93412 |
Volare |
Essesoul |
Bryan Lee |
Horus |
|
Steam |
2nthony |
Aiello |
Ayaka Neko |
Po Chen |
Hyzhao |
Liusishan |
|
Ranger |
支持
- 我有两只猫,一只叫汤圆,一只叫可乐,假如觉得 Pake 让�?生活更美好,可以给汤圆可乐 喂罐头
🥩 🍤 。 - 如果�?喜欢 Pake,可以在 Github Star,更欢迎 推荐 给�?志同道合的朋友使用。
- 可以关注我的 Twitter 获取到最新的 Pake 更新消息,也欢迎�?入 Telegram 聊天群。
最后
- 希望大伙玩的过程中有一种学�?新技术的喜悦感,如果有新点子欢迎告诉我。
- 假如�?发现有很适合做成桌面 App 的网页也很欢迎告诉我,我给�?到里面来。








